Default Will 2005 WRX seats fit a 93 Legacy Wgn?

i know the earlier years of wrx seats will fit, though the headroom kinda disappears but was wondering about the later years, especially the 2005.

They will bolt right in.

Don't touch the seat rails. Just use the WRX rails and seats as a whole.

And yeah they will set a bit higher than the stock seats.

The fronts are dirrect bolt ons.

The rears however will not fit, even if you get a wagon rear you'd have to custom fab some brackets to get them to work.

I sold my 02 seats to a 94 legacy, so this is going off of the test fits we did in his car :P

02-07 mounting brackets are the same, the seats change a little in between the years though.
